Community Impact Awards for Mental Health & Belonging

In honor of Mental Health Awareness Month, The WeBelong Institute is proud to recognize individuals and organizations who have made a meaningful impact on mental health and well-being within their communities.

The Community Impact Awards celebrate people whose actions — whether through advocacy, service, creativity, leadership, or quiet dedication — have strengthened connection, reduced stigma, and improved access to mental health support. These awards honor those who lead with compassion and actively contribute to a culture of belonging.

Award recipients will be recognized during The WeBelong Institute Red Carpet Benefit Gala on Thursday, September 10th for World Suicide Prevention Day, at the Mission Beach Women’s Club.

Call for Submissions / Nominations

Submit a Nomination

The WeBelong Institute invites community members to submit nominations for individuals or groups who have demonstrated a commitment to improving mental health and supporting others in meaningful, community-centered ways.

Nominees may include, but are not limited to:

  • Community leaders or advocates

  • Educators or school-based professionals

  • Mental health practitioners

  • Artists, creatives, or organizers using their work to promote healing

  • Volunteers or grassroots leaders

  • Individuals with lived experience who are making a difference for others

Formal credentials are not required. Impact, integrity, and community contribution are the primary criteria.

Selection Criteria

Nominations will be reviewed based on:

  • Demonstrated impact on mental health or emotional well-being

  • Contribution to community connection or belonging

  • Commitment to reducing stigma or increasing access to support

  • Alignment with The Belonging Lab’s mission and values

Awards are intended to recognize both visible leadership and behind-the-scenes community care.
